Virtual IOP offers numerous benefits to the residents of Warbranch. With flexible scheduling, individuals can participate in therapy without disrupting their work, school, or family commitments. Engaging in therapy through HIPAA-compliant video conferencing provides a level of convenience that encourages participation, ensuring that those struggling with depression, anxiety, PTSD, and other issues can receive the help they need.
These programs typically involve 9-20 hours of structured therapy each week, with sessions occurring 3-5 days a week. You’ll be matched with licensed therapists for individual and group sessions, including options for family therapy.
